Job Summary
Freewheel is currently looking to recruit a Data Scientist to join our Audience Revenue Science Team. This role will be responsible for supporting product development efforts related to in-depth data analysis, machine learning, AI, optimization methods, and statistical model building. This role will work very closely with engineering and product management staff to support the development of innovative approaches to the next generation of ad tech products.

Job Description

Responsibilities:
  • Collaborating with cross-functional teams to define data analysis problems and design experiments
  • Engineering software solutions and algorithms for data cleansing, integration, and analysis
  • Utilizing advanced statistical methods and machine learning to derive actionable insights from big data
  • Implementing statistical and mathematical models to address complex business challenges
  • Constructing data mining frameworks and conducting trend analysis for strategic decision-making
  • Analyzing complex datasets to identify historical patterns in customer and product behaviors
  • Building predictive models to forecast customer actions and guide business planning
  • Synthesizing findings from data science research to inform and optimize business processes
  • Presenting data-driven insights and recommendations through clear, comprehensive deliverables
